The genetic interplay between body mass index, breast size and breast cancer risk: a Mendelian randomization analysis

BACKGROUND: Evidence linking breast size to breast cancer risk has been inconsistent, and its interpretation is often hampered by confounding factors such as body mass index (BMI).
